Subject: [RFC -v2 02/16] Bluetooth: Remove sk_sndtimeo from l2cap_core.c

We now have a new struct member in l2cap_chan to store this value for
access inside l2cap_core.c
Signed-off-by: Gustavo Padovan <gustavo.padovan@collabora.co.uk>
---
include/net/bluetooth/l2cap.h | 1 +
net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c | 7 +++----
net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c | 1 +
3 files changed, 5 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/include/net/bluetooth/l2cap.h b/include/net/bluetooth/l2cap.h
index 6040743..cf94e68 100644
--- a/include/net/bluetooth/l2cap.h
+++ b/include/net/bluetooth/l2cap.h
@@ -480,6 +480,7 @@ struct l2cap_chan {
__u8 tx_state;
__u8 rx_state;
+ unsigned long sndtimeo;
unsigned long conf_state;
unsigned long conn_state;
unsigned long flags;
diff --git a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c
index ae51965..c854789 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_core.c
@@ -630,7 +630,7 @@ void l2cap_chan_close(struct l2cap_chan *chan, int reason)
case BT_CONFIG:
if (chan->chan_type == L2CAP_CHAN_CONN_ORIENTED &&
conn->hcon->type == ACL_LINK) {
- __set_chan_timer(chan, sk->sk_sndtimeo);
+ __set_chan_timer(chan, chan->sndtimeo);
l2cap_send_disconn_req(chan, reason);
} else
l2cap_chan_del(chan, reason);
@@ -1602,7 +1602,6 @@ static struct l2cap_chan *l2cap_global_chan_by_psm(int state, __le16 psm,
int l2cap_chan_connect(struct l2cap_chan *chan, __le16 psm, u16 cid,
bdaddr_t *dst, u8 dst_type)
{
- struct sock *sk = chan->sk;
bdaddr_t *src = &chan->src;
struct l2cap_conn *conn;
struct hci_conn *hcon;
@@ -1716,7 +1715,7 @@ int l2cap_chan_connect(struct l2cap_chan *chan, __le16 psm, u16 cid,
l2cap_chan_lock(chan);
l2cap_state_change(chan, BT_CONNECT);
- __set_chan_timer(chan, sk->sk_sndtimeo);
+ __set_chan_timer(chan, chan->sndtimeo);
if (hcon->state == BT_CONNECTED) {
if (chan->chan_type != L2CAP_CHAN_CONN_ORIENTED) {
@@ -3641,7 +3640,7 @@ static struct l2cap_chan *l2cap_connect(struct l2cap_conn *conn,
dcid = chan->scid;
- __set_chan_timer(chan, sk->sk_sndtimeo);
+ __set_chan_timer(chan, chan->sndtimeo);
chan->ident = cmd->ident;
diff --git a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c
index 0977966..221aef9 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/l2cap_sock.c
@@ -1178,6 +1178,7 @@ static void l2cap_sock_init(struct sock *sk, struct sock *parent)
/* Default config options */
chan->flush_to = L2CAP_DEFAULT_FLUSH_TO;
+ chan->sndtimeo = sk->sk_sndtimeo;
chan->data = sk;
chan->ops = &l2cap_chan_ops;
